Λευΐ
G3017
Transliteration: Leuḯ
Pronunciation: lyoo'-ee
Definition: Levi
Λευΐ (Leuḯ | lyoo'-ee)
[Grk]Λευΐ , Λευί , Λευΐ LN: 93.231 GK: G3322" class="dictionary-topic-link">G3322 Hebrew: לֵוִי
Derivation: of Hebrew origin (H3878" class="dictionary-topic-link">H3878);
Strong's: Levi, the name of three Israelites
KJV: --Levi. Compare G3018" class="dictionary-topic-link">G3018.
